Definitions
porker
noun
A pig, especially one that is fattened for its meat.
The farmer raised a porker to sell at the market.
A person who is overweight.
He jokingly referred to himself as a porker after indulging in too many holiday treats.
porker
adjective
Relating to pigs fattened for pork or suitable for pork production.
Feed costs for porker pigs have risen this season.
